The chairs at BANE are available all year, in all locations. They aim to meet all of their customers' needs. In line with this, BANE's volunteers will ask ask what times suit you best for picking up and returning equipment.
Please book chairs in advance of your beach visit.
The British weather is renowned for its unpredictability, especially on the Northern coast. If you wish to cancel your trip because of weather (or other circumstances), please contact BANE asap. Alternatively, if the weather takes a turn for the worse while you're out and about, ring the contact number provided when you pick up the equipment. This is to let them know you want to return the chair(s) for any reason.
Firstly, yourself and a friend! To use their equipment, BANE asks customers to bring photo ID with them. When picking up the equipment, BANE's volunteers will ask for your contact information and will ask you to sign a disclaimer.
BANE recommends that you bring suntan lotions, blankets, towels and other beach necessities! They also recommend that the person pushing the chair wears sensible shoes with a good grip.
BANE's equipment is available to anyone who has difficulty walking on a beach. They aim to make beaches accessible for everybody! To use a beach wheelchair, a friend or family member is needed to push them.
The only hoist available is at BANE's Whitley Bay location.
Unfortunately, BANE's volunteers are unable to assist customers when transferring to their beach wheelchairs. They also cannot join you on your beach adventure. Users must bring an adult helper to assist with these factors.
BANE kindly allows customers to store their own wheelchair/ walking aids in their storage facilities while they're out and about.
